In the coming years, starting in 2026, there are three major trends that are predicted to significantly impact the retail industry:

1. Direct Purchases Through Social Media:
Social commerce has been on the rise, with consumers increasingly turning to social media platforms to discover new products and make purchases. A recent survey found that 47% of consumers in the US have shopped using social media, and 33% stated that social media marketing influenced their purchasing decisions. This trend is especially prominent among Generation Z consumers, with three-quarters of them reporting that social media plays a role in their shopping habits.

The largest social media platform, Facebook, has capitalized on this trend by introducing the Facebook Marketplace, which has seen massive success with one billion users and one million stores on the platform. TikTok, another popular social media platform, has also seen success with the introduction of TikTok Shopping, a feature that allows merchants to sell products directly on the platform. As a result, TikTok users are twice as likely to make purchases compared to users of other social media platforms.

2. Online Grocery Shopping:
The pandemic has accelerated the growth of online grocery shopping, with sales increasing dramatically in recent years. In 2020, online grocery sales in the US reached $95.82 billion, accounting for 11% of total food sales. This trend is not limited to the US, as online grocery sales have also seen significant growth in other countries as well. China leads the pack with the highest online grocery expenditure, followed by South Korea and the US.

Online grocery shopping is expected to continue growing in the coming years, with global sales projected to reach over $2.1 trillion by 2030. This growth has been driven by the convenience and safety of online shopping, as well as the increased number of consumers who have tried online grocery shopping for the first time during the pandemic.

3. Expansion of Online Shopping Across All Product Categories:
The popularity of online shopping has extended beyond groceries to other product categories as well. In 2020, household products, footwear, and clothing saw significant growth in online sales. Consumers have indicated that they plan to continue shopping online even after the pandemic, which has led to increased spending in categories such as home improvement, meal delivery, and online fitness.

With the rise of e-commerce platforms, retailers are exploring new product possibilities and expanding their online offerings. As online shopping becomes more widespread, businesses are finding new ways to connect with customers and provide them with a seamless shopping experience.
